oracle数据表恢复,应对数据丢失的解决方案
Oracle数据表恢复:应对数据丢失的解决方案

在信息化时代,数据是企业的核心资产。Oracle数据库作为企业级数据库,其稳定性和可靠性备受信赖。数据丢失或损坏的情况时有发生,如何进行Oracle数据表恢复成为企业IT人员关注的焦点。本文将详细介绍Oracle数据表恢复的方法和步骤,帮助您应对数据丢失的挑战。
标签:数据丢失

数据丢失是Oracle数据库面临的主要问题之一。数据丢失的原因可能包括人为误操作、系统故障、硬件故障、网络问题等。以下是一些常见的数据丢失情况:
误删除数据表或数据记录
数据文件损坏或丢失
系统故障导致数据损坏
网络问题导致数据传输失败
标签:数据恢复方法

针对不同的数据丢失情况,Oracle提供了多种数据恢复方法。以下是一些常用的数据恢复方法:
1. 使用数据库备份恢复
数据库备份是数据恢复的基础。当数据丢失时,可以通过备份集来恢复数据库。以下是使用数据库备份恢复的步骤:
检查备份集的有效性
使用RMA或DBMS_RECOVERY工具恢复数据库
根据备份时间点恢复数据
验证恢复后的数据完整性
2. 使用闪回技术恢复
Oracle数据库的闪回技术可以在数据库发生故障时,将数据恢复到最近的一个一致状态。以下是使用闪回技术恢复的步骤:
启用闪回数据库功能
使用闪回查询、闪回事务或闪回恢复功能恢复数据
验证恢复后的数据完整性
3. 使用数据恢复工具恢复
当数据库发生故障,无法直接使用备份或闪回技术恢复数据时,可以使用第三方数据恢复工具。以下是一些常用的数据恢复工具:
Oracle数据库恢复工具(DBR)
Sellar Daa Recovery
ApexSQL Log
标签:数据恢复步骤

以下是Oracle数据表恢复的通用步骤:
1. 确定数据丢失原因
在开始数据恢复之前,首先要确定数据丢失的原因。这有助于选择合适的数据恢复方法。
2. 分析数据备份和日志文件
分析数据库备份和日志文件,了解数据丢失的时间点和范围。这有助于确定恢复数据的范围和策略。
3. 选择数据恢复方法
根据数据丢失的原因和恢复需求,选择合适的数据恢复方法。例如,如果数据丢失是由于误删除,则可以使用闪回技术恢复;如果数据丢失是由于数据文件损坏,则可以使用数据恢复工具恢复。
4. 执行数据恢复操作
按照所选的数据恢复方法,执行数据恢复操作。在恢复过程中,注意以下几点:
确保恢复操作在安全的环境下进行
备份恢复过程中的关键步骤
验证恢复后的数据完整性
5. 恢复数据后验证
在数据恢复完成后,对恢复后的数据进行验证,确保数据完整性和一致性。
标签:

Oracle数据表恢复是保障企业数据安全的重要环节。通过了解数据丢失的原因、选择合适的数据恢复方法以及遵循正确的恢复步骤,可以有效应对数据丢失的挑战。在实际操作中,企业应加强数据备份和安全管理,降低数据丢失的风险。
本站所有文章、数据、图片均来自互联网,一切版权均归源网站或源作者所有。
如果侵犯了你的权益请来信告知我们删除。邮箱: